What's New

ZCS Zimbra Classic now has an updated OpenSSL version (OpenSSL 1.0.2t-fips).
ZCO Documentation has been updated to reflect currently supported platforms. Note that Windows 7 is officially End-of-Life as of January 2020, so ZCO support on that OS has ended as well.
ZCO When creating server rules using Zimbra Connector for Outlook, users can now have the options - "Delete It" and "Delete permanently" - for emails matching the defined criteria.
ZCO Earlier when creating rules, selecting a condition, and moving to the next screen, users sometimes encountered errors. This issue is now fixed.
Zimbra Docs Documentation has been updated to reflect currently supported platforms. Note that Windows 7 is officially End-of-Life as of January 2020, so is no longer supported by Zimbra.

Fixed Issues

ZCS Users were unable to collect logs using `zmdialog` after updating to 8.8.15 Patch5 and saw an openJDK error. This issue is now fixed.
ZCS Changes introduced with iOS 13 have modified the behavior of IMAP sync from Apple devices. Those devices now sync all folders continuously, which impacts the mailbox process performance.
ZWC Fixed a bug in the Admin Web Console to ensure that Class-of-Service Retention Policy changes are properly applied to the selected COS. Previously, changing these values for successive COSes would cause the first selected COS to be updated with changes intended for the later COS.
ZWC With a Japanese language preference set, the expected Firstname Lastname order was not preserved when contacts were added from .vcf attachments that were forwarded as email attachments. Such contacts now have their "FileAs" option set to ensure the surname appears first.
ZWC When users deleted or renamed a contact group, the contact list view did not update to reflect the changes. This issue is now fixed.
ZCO Ensured that shares that have been previously mounted will not be remounted when the owner's account has an alias.
ZCO Contact group members of groups imported from PST files would not be populated because the referenced contacts were not known to Outlook. It that situation, such members are now imported as inline contacts and will sync to the Zimbra server.
ZCO Contact group members that were added to a group by selecting a contact's _alternate_ email address would not sync to the Zimbra server. Such members are now converted to inline group members upon synchronization.
Zimbra Connect Contact auto-complete had used GAL contacts only, requiring full email address to be entered to initiate conversations with other contacts via the "Speak to your friends" textbox. All the users' contacts are now used.
Zimbra Docs The current cursor position in a document being edited is now retained when the user navigates to other tabs and then returns.

Known Issues

Zimbra Connect Beginning in 8.8.15, Chat History is ID-based instead of email-based: if a mailbox is deleted and then a new mailbox with the same email address is created, the history of the old mailbox will not be available to the new mailbox.


Patch Installation

Please refer to the steps below to install 8.8.15 Patch 6 on Redhat and Ubuntu platforms:

Before Installing the Patch

Before installing the patch, consider the following:

  • Patches are cumulative.
  • A full backup should be performed before any patch is applied. There is no automated roll-back.
  • Zimlet patches can include removing existing Zimlets and redeploying the patched Zimlet.
  • Only files or Zimlets associated with installed packages will be installed from the patch.
  • Switch to zimbra user before using ZCS CLI commands.
  • Important! You cannot revert to the previous ZCS release after you upgrade to the patch.
  • Important Note for ZCS Setup with Local ZCS repository: Customers who have set up local ZCS repository should first update the local repository by following instructions in wiki
  • Please make note that, installing the zimbra-patch package only updates the Zimbra core packages.

Redhat

Installing Zimbra packages with system package upgrades

  • As root, first clear the yum cache and check for updates so the server sees there is a new zimbra-patch package in the patch repository:
yum clean metadata
yum check-update
  • Then ask yum to update available packages:
yum update
  • Restart ZCS as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mcontrol restart

Installing Zimbra packages individually

Install/Upgrade zimbra-proxy-components on Proxy node for FOSS and NETWORK

  • As root, first clear the yum cache and check for updates so the server sees all updated packages in the patch repository:
yum clean metadata
yum check-update
  • Then install the package:
yum install zimbra-proxy-components
  • Restart proxy as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mproxyctl restart

Install/Upgrade zimbra-proxy-patch on Proxy node for FOSS and NETWORK

  • As root, install the package:
yum install zimbra-proxy-patch
  • Restart proxy as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mproxyctl restart
zmmemcachedctl restart

Install/Upgrade zimbra-mta-components on MTA node for FOSS and NETWORK

  • As root, first clear the yum cache and check for updates so the server sees all updated packages in the patch repository:
yum clean metadata
yum check-update
  • Then install the package:
yum install zimbra-mta-components
  • Restart amavisd as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mamavisdctl restart

Install/Upgrade zimbra-mta-patch on MTA node for FOSS and NETWORK

  • As root, install the package:
yum install zimbra-mta-patch
  • Restart amavisd as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mamavisdctl restart

Install/Upgrade zimbra-patch on mailstore node for FOSS and NETWORK

  • As root, install the package:
yum install zimbra-patch
  • Restart ZCS as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mcontrol restart

Install/Upgrade zimbra-chat for FOSS

  • As root, install the package:
yum install zimbra-chat
  • Restart Zimbra mailbox service as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mmailboxdctl restart

Uninstall zimbra-talk (NETWORK Only)

Starting Zimbra 8.8.15 GA, zimbra-connect replaces zimbra-talk hence it is important to remove zimbra-talk before installing zimbra-connect.

  • As root, uninstall the package:
yum remove zimbra-talk

Install/Upgrade zimbra-network-modules-ng, zimbra-connect and zimbra-zimlet-auth (NETWORK Only)

  • As root, first clear the yum cache and check for updates so the server sees all updated packages in the patch repository:
yum clean metadata
yum check-update
  • Then install the packages:
yum install zimbra-network-modules-ng
yum install zimbra-connect
yum install zimbra-zimlet-auth
  • Restart Zimbra mailbox service as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mmailboxdctl restart

Install/Upgrade zimbra-docs (NETWORK Only)

  • As root, install the package:
yum install zimbra-docs
  • Restart Zimbra mailbox service as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mmailboxdctl restart

Install/Upgrade zimbra-drive-ng (NETWORK Only)

  • As root, install the package:
yum install zimbra-drive-ng
  • Restart Zimbra mailbox service as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mmailboxdctl restart

Upgrade OpenLDAP on LDAP node for FOSS and NETWORK

  • As root, install the package:
yum install zimbra-ldap-components
  • Restart ldap as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
ldap restart

Ubuntu

Installing zimbra packages with system package upgrades

  • As root, check for updates so the server sees there is a new zimbra-patch package in the patch repository:
apt-get update
  • Then update available packages:
apt-get upgrade

OR

  • Update all available packages plus any kernel updates:
apt-get dist-upgrade
  • Restart ZCS as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mcontrol restart

Installing zimbra packages individually

Install/Upgrade zimbra-proxy-components on Proxy node for FOSS and NETWORK

  • As root, install package
apt-get install zimbra-proxy-components
  • Restart proxy as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mproxyctl restart

Install/Upgrade zimbra-proxy-patch on Proxy node for FOSS and NETWORK

  • As root, install package
apt-get install zimbra-proxy-patch
  • Restart proxy as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mproxyctl restart
zmmemcachedctl restart

Ubuntu 18 zimbra-proxy-patch version

zimbra-proxy-patch        ->  8.8.12.1554984827.p3-1

The installation of this patch is mandatory for the proxy to function on Ubuntu 18 servers.

Install/Upgrade zimbra-mta-components on MTA node for FOSS and NETWORK

  • As root, install package
apt-get install zimbra-mta-components
  • Restart amavisd as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mamavisdctl restart

Install/Upgrade zimbra-mta-patch on MTA node for FOSS and NETWORK

  • As root, install package
apt-get install zimbra-mta-patch
  • Restart amavisd as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mamavisdctl restart

Install/Upgrade zimbra-patch on mailstore node for FOSS and NETWORK

  • As root, check for updates and install package:
apt-get update
apt-get install zimbra-patch
  • Restart ZCS as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mcontrol restart

Install/Upgrade zimbra-chat for FOSS

  • As root, install package:
apt-get install zimbra-chat
  • Restart Zimbra mailbox service as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mmailboxdctl restart

Uninstall zimbra-talk (NETWORK Only)

Starting Zimbra 8.8.15 GA, zimbra-connect replaces zimbra-talk hence it is important to remove zimbra-talk before installing zimbra-connect.

  • As root, uninstall the package:
apt-get remove zimbra-talk

Install/Upgrade zimbra-network-modules-ng, zimbra-connect and zimbra-zimlet-auth (NETWORK Only)

  • As root, check for updates and install packages:
apt-get update
apt-get install zimbra-network-modules-ng
apt-get install zimbra-connect
apt-get install zimbra-zimlet-auth
  • Restart Zimbra mailbox service as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mmailboxdctl restart

Install/Upgrade zimbra-docs (NETWORK Only)

  • As root, install package:
apt-get install zimbra-docs
  • Restart Zimbra mailbox service as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mmailboxdctl restart

Install/Upgrade zimbra-drive-ng (NETWORK Only)

  • As root, install package:
apt-get install zimbra-drive-ng
  • Restart Zimbra mailbox service as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
zmmailboxdctl restart

Upgrade OpenLDAP on LDAP node for FOSS and NETWORK

  • As root, install the package:
apt-get install zimbra-ldap-components
  • Restart ldap as zimbra user:
su - zimbra
ldap restart

Upgrade openssl for FOSS and NETWORK

Red Hat

  • As root. Type
yum install zimbra-openssl

Ubuntu

  • As root. Type
apt-get install zimbra-openssl
